Its been 6 months since my ATG .. In July I was heading to a stem cell transplant full steam .. in August things started to change .. In October -- we have remission ..

I feel like I need to have one of those signs that says "Its been X days since the last industrial accident" only in my case it would say "transfusion" In this case its been over [45] days since I've needed a transfusion of any kind.

The days are sometimes good .. sometimes bad .. there are many new aches and pains to get used to .. occasional hot flashes .. cold sweats. Fevers, chills, etc ..

The good news is .. all the counts are up .. H&H is almost normal. Platelets are above 50 and climbing at the rate of 2-4k a week. The doctor is even starting to say "remission" and other positive things about my case ..

The real issue is .. noone knows why .. We want to credit it to the ATG, but its just past the point where ATG is supposed have been effective .. Though they tell us there has been one other case where there has been a delayed response to the ATG. Noone knows if it is truly stable either .. but for now . I will take it.
